[ ] Schema registry check — before approving, confirm the new event schemas are registered in Fennelwick with compatibility mode BACKWARD, not NONE (people keep doing this, please catch it). Run the contract diff against the last prod snapshot and make sure no required fields were dropped. If the diff is clean, you're good. The registry snapshot this checklist was verified against is listed below.

pipeline stamp: htk9_6ce9d33c5

Handover note — Crumbwheel order cutoffs.

Welcome aboard. The bakery cutoff rule in Crumbwheel closes same-day orders at 14:00 local to each storefront, not UTC — this has bitten us twice. Holiday overrides live in the calendar service and take precedence silently, so always check there first when a cutoff looks wrong. To unlock the calendar service's admin console after a restart, enter the recovery passphrase below.

vault phrase of bagap-bahaf = silion-pelox-sorox-casdor-quenwyn-fraax-eliox-praael-kelion-quenvan-kasox-rusael-norius-belvan

### Onboarding: Calendar Sync Conflicts (Release Duty)

Welcome aboard! Our release calendar in Tidewheel sometimes double-books freeze windows when the Moorhen sync job races the manual scheduler. If you see conflicting entries, don't delete anything — run the reconcile tool from the release workstation. It needs an unlocked release keyring, which on a fresh machine means restoring it first. The restore prompt asks for the recovery passphrase below.

unlock words, hahip-baduf: holwyn-istath-julvan

For heads of department: Ostrevane Holdings has opened renegotiation of the Harrowdale campus lease, which expires in fourteen months. We are pursuing a shorter five-year term with a break clause, reflecting uncertainty around headcount across the Velmora and Kestwick sites. Facilities has prepared comparative costings for relocation versus renewal, and legal is reviewing the landlord's counterproposal carefully. Please hold all space-planning commitments until terms are settled. The broader reasoning appears in the confidential note below.

confidential, kagep-kahof: Druokax Systems plans to lower the Ulaath list price by 53 percent in March.